About the Item

A Pair of Antique Victorian Mahogany hall chairs with carved crest backs. This beautiful pair of 19th century antique Mahogany hall chairs boast excellent craftsmanship and timeless Victorian elegance. Crafted from solid mahogany, each chair features a striking arched backrest adorned with a beautifully carved crest and central shield motif, adding a touch grandeur. A showcase of excellent craftsmanship. Each detail showcases character from the silhouette of the legs to the curve at the front of the seat. It has subtle yet beautiful detailing. This pair of Victorian chairs can be a perfect addition to any space, from a hallway / entry space, accent seating in a bedroom to additional occasional seating in a living / entertaining room. Dimensions: Height: 88 cm Width: 40 cm Depth: 34 cm Seat height: 44 cm
